Console commands are commands that can be entered in the game's console window to alter the game's settings, variables, or functions. They can be used to cheat, debug, or experiment with the game. Some console commands can be used to play as a bandit in Skyrim, such as changing your faction allegiance, spawning items or enemies, or teleporting to different locations. Here are some examples of console commands that can be useful for playing as a bandit:
player.addtofaction e0cd9 0: This command adds you to the Bandit Ally faction, which makes all bandits friendly to you and hostile to everyone else.player.additem f x: This command adds x amount of gold to your inventory.player.additem 13989 1: This command adds a steel sword to your inventory.player.placeatme 00023ABF 10: This command spawns 10 imperial soldiers at your location.coc Whiterun: This command teleports you to Whiterun.To use console commands, press the tilde key () on your keyboard to open the console window. Then type in the command and press enter. To close the console window, press the tilde key again. Be careful when using console commands, as they may cause bugs or glitches in the game. It is recommended to save your game before using them.
